Nevada Code § 628.130

Seal; records of proceedings; maintenance of and posting of certain information on website

The
Board shall:
1. Have a seal of which judicial notice
must be taken.
2. Keep records of its proceedings. In any
proceedings in court, civil or criminal, arising out of or founded upon any
provision of this chapter, copies of those records certified as correct under
the seal of the Board are admissible in evidence as tending to prove the
contents of the records.
3. Maintain a website on the Internet or
its successor and post on its website:
(a) The names arranged alphabetically by
classifications of all accountants and business entities holding certificates,
registrations or permits under this chapter.
(b) The names of the members of the Board.
(c) Such other matter as may be deemed proper by
the Board.
